how to read it

Three of these are not what they look like

Two layers sit at 100% by definition. “The code is read” and “every function tagged” count the inventory against itself — every function is in the list of functions. They mean a row exists, not that anything is understood.

The review queue is worth less than it reads. Checking its entries against what actually runs at runtime showed roughly three quarters were live code. High coverage of a question nobody can afford to answer.

The last-place layers are the commercial ones — untrusted input reaching danger, dangerous libraries, obsolete libraries, and what the code is meant to be. Those catch the expensive mistakes, and the climb has barely begun.

Five layers are classifications, and the analyzer now says so itself. A classification answers “what is this” with one row per thing — a file has one role, a symbol one colour — so its 100% is a different achievement from an analysis at 100%. Those rows are labelled and greyed. The density column shows facts per covered unit for everything else: control flow carries 19.4, resources 25.2, taint 8.1. A low density on an analysis layer is the thing to look at — reachability and purity both sit at 1.0.

The range is five independent counts, not one. qa answers per function, but a function is a poor unit of size — a three-line __repr__ weighs the same as a two-hundred-line handler. So the same coverage is recounted straight from the source four more ways: lines of function body, statements, AST nodes, and branch points. The column shows the full range; hover it for each figure. A narrow range means the answer is robust to how you count. A wide one means the layer's coverage is skewed — errors reach 4% of functions but up to 12% of the code, so what it misses is small functions; resources span 38–55% for the same reason.

These bars measure completeness, not usefulness — and that is a known gap, not an oversight. A layer at 94% has an answer for 94% of the base. It says nothing about whether those answers are right. Nothing on this page is a precision figure. The plan now names a ground-truth and evaluation layer — human labels, validator decisions, false-positive reasons, precision and recall — as the highest product priority, in its own words “because it keeps the green bars honest”. Until it exists, the only precision numbers anyone has here are hand-adjudicated: 41 of 43 on the largest severe block, 2 of 2 on architecture findings, 4 of 7 on SQL, checked by reading the flagged code.

Every gap here is a stated unknown, not a blind spot. The bars show evidence coverage — how much of each base has a source-linked answer. Measured the other way, answer coverage is 100% on every layer: every function has a determinate result, and where that result is "unknown" the analyzer records why. The reason is printed under each row. A tool that reports nothing found and a tool that reports why it could not tell are not the same tool, and this is the second.

The rows do not share a denominator. Most are a fraction of the 1,841 functions, but repository topology and vocabulary are over all paths, artifact roles over files, documentation over production files only, dependencies over import edges, and test topology over tests. Each row states its own base, because a single one would be a lie about most of them.

Two numbers read worse than reality. “What actually runs” reflects an unfinished call map rather than dead code — the test suite executes far more than it reports. And “where the program starts” is low by nature: a program has few entry points.

The whole-run duration is not in the artifact. qa’s telemetry declares a duration_ms field and hardcodes it to None, so a reading published from their export carries no run time at all. Row 1 is populated only when this page ran the export itself, or when qa reported a figure by hand, and 2 of 4 recorded exports have one. I have asked them to populate the field; every export would then be a measurement instead of an anecdote.

Row 2 is a phase, not the run. It is the interval between built_at, stamped when qa constructs the semantic index, and generated_at, stamped when the export document starts being assembled. It covers index construction and every pass after it. It excludes discovery, parsing and AST work before it, and document assembly, encoding and the write after it. It is charted because it is the only duration every artifact can support. An export served from a cached index is skipped rather than plotted, because then the interval measures the age of the cache and not any work done.
